Similarly, How cold does it get in Aurora IL?
In Aurora, July is the warmest month of the year, with an average high of 83°F and low of 64°F. From December 1 to March 3, the cold season lasts for 3.0 months, with an average daily high temperature below 41°F. With an average low of 17°F and high of 31°F, January is the coldest month of the year in Aurora.
Also, it is asked, What is the temperature of a typical winter day in Aurora Illinois?
Daily highs hover around 31°F, seldom dropping below 14°F or rising over 46°F. On January 22, the daily maximum temperature is at its lowest, 30°F. Daily lows hover around 17°F, seldom dropping below -4°F or rising beyond 34°F. On January 29, the lowest daily average low temperature is 16°F.

Has it ever snowed in July in Denver?
The only months of the year in which the city has never had appreciable snowfall are July and August.
How long is snow in Colorado?
Denver typically has its first winter snowfall in October, although it may sometimes start as early as September or as late as November. In April or May, the final snowfall of the season occurs. In June, July, and August of every year, Denver is often free of snow.

How does barometric pressure affect your body?
High barometric pressure exerts additional pressure upon our bodies, which restricts how much tissue can expand. On the other side, when the air pressure in the atmosphere is low, our body’s tissues may expand more, which increases pressure on our nerves and other body components.
Does low air pressure cause headaches?
After a decline in barometric pressure, headaches related to barometric pressure develop. Although they have the same physical symptoms as a regular headache or migraine, you could also experience nausea and vomiting.
What barometric pressure causes headaches?
We discovered that migraine often started just before cyclones formed. We discovered that migraines were most likely to occur in the range of 1003 to 1007 hPa, or 6–10 hPa below typical atmospheric pressure.

Is Ukraine Hot or cold?
Ukraine has a typical continental climate like its neighbors Romania, Poland, and Belarus, with severely cold winters and mild, sometimes scorching, summers. The country’s capital, Kyiv, in the north, has summer temperatures that typically range from the mid-20s to slightly below freezing.
How hot does it get in Ukraine?
The average yearly temperature in Ukraine is 7-9°C. Less than 18°C to 22°C on average throughout the summer (May to August). The average winter temperature (December to March) ranges from -4.8°C to 2°C.

How often does it snow in Aurora CO?
The amount of snowfall each month varies seasonally in Aurora. From October 9 to April 25, the snowiest 6.5 months of the year, with a minimum 31-day snowfall of 1.0 inches, occur. With an average snowfall of 2.4 inches, March is the snowiest month in Aurora.

How hot is the aurora borealis?
That source claims that the electron plasma in an aurora has a temperature range of 500 K to 1400 K. However, keep in mind that the density of the plasma and, thus, its overall heat capacity are quite low; the height at which auroras occur is essentially that of outer space.
Does it snow in California?
Surprisingly, there are areas of California where it does snow. The Sierra Nevada Mountain Ranges and Big Bear Lake, for example, have a “snow season” in the winter, despite California’s reputation for always being sunny and never becoming too cold.
